How To Fix S_CUS_ACTIVITY020 - Specify customizing objects with unique keys


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: S_CUS_ACTIVITY - Customizing Activity

  • Message number: 020

  • Message text: Specify customizing objects with unique keys

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    Customizing objects have been entered with the same object names,
    object type, transaction code, and the same or no subobject.

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    Customizing objects can only be saved with a unique key.

    System Response

    How to fix this error?

    Change the customizing objects or specify different transaction codes
    or subobjects.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message S_CUS_ACTIVITY020 - Specify customizing objects with unique keys ?

    The SAP error message S_CUS_ACTIVITY020 indicates that there is an issue with the customizing objects in your SAP system. This error typically arises when you are trying to create or modify a customizing activity that requires unique keys for the objects involved, but the system has detected that the keys are not unique.

    Cause:

    1. Non-Unique Keys: The most common cause of this error is that the customizing objects you are trying to work with do not have unique identifiers. This can happen if multiple entries exist with the same key values in the customizing tables.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: Sometimes, the configuration settings may not be set up correctly, leading to conflicts in the keys.
    3. Transport Issues: If you are transporting customizing settings from one system to another, there may be conflicts or duplicates in the keys.

    Solution:

    To resolve the S_CUS_ACTIVITY020 error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check Customizing Entries:

      • Go to the relevant customizing transaction (e.g., SPRO) and check the entries for the customizing objects you are working with.
      • Ensure that all entries have unique keys. If you find duplicates, you will need to modify or delete the conflicting entries.
    2. Review Configuration:

      • Review the configuration settings to ensure that they are set up correctly. Make sure that the keys are defined properly and that there are no overlaps.
    3. Transport Management:

      • If the issue arose after a transport, check the transport logs for any errors or warnings related to the customizing objects.
      • Ensure that the transport requests do not contain conflicting entries.
    4. Use Transaction SE11:

      • You can use transaction SE11 (Data Dictionary) to check the relevant tables for the customizing objects. Look for any duplicate entries in the tables that might be causing the issue.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ific customizing objects you are working with. There may be specific guidelines or known issues that can help you resolve the error.
    6. Contact SAP Support:

      • If you are unable to resolve the issue on your own,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ance. They can provide more detailed guidance based on your specific situation.
